Emotions Make Conversations Hard
- Difficult conversations often involve intense emotions like anger, frustration, or jealousy that can cause physical reactions. - People rarely learn skills to handle these emotional, challenging conversations early in life, making them tricky.
Prepare Before Conversations
- Prepare mentally and emotionally before difficult conversations by clarifying what and how to say it. - Consider timing, tone, and setting to create the right environment for meaningful dialogue.
